[PATCH] install.texi: Use sourceware.org.


In BZ # 13963 a user notices that we don't consistently use
sourceware.org. 

This patch changes the manual to use sourceware.org.

2012-04-09  Carlos O'Donell  <carlos_odonell@mentor.com>

       [BZ # 13963]
       * manual/install.texi: Use sourceware.org.

diff --git a/manual/install.texi b/manual/install.texi
index 00db2b8..222ab3d 100644
--- a/manual/install.texi
+++ b/manual/install.texi
@@ -447,7 +447,7 @@ It is a good idea to verify that the problem has not already been
 reported.  Bugs are documented in two places: The file @file{BUGS}
 describes a number of well known bugs and the bug tracking system has a
 WWW interface at
-@url{http://sources.redhat.com/bugzilla/}.  The WWW
+@url{http://sourceware.org/bugzilla/}.  The WWW
 interface gives you access to open and closed reports.  A closed report
 normally includes a patch or a hint on solving the problem.
